The Benefits of Data Analytics - 23566

Organizations today are loaded with various business systems that capture enormous amounts of data. The challenge is not only processing large amounts of data but sifting through these vast amounts of raw data to make decisions and identify potential anomalies to support business compliance. Hanford Mission Integrated Solutions (HMIS), a limited liability company consisting of Leidos, Centerra and Parsons operating the Hanford Mission Essential Services Contract (HMESC) for the Department of Energy (DOE) at the Hanford Site in Richland, Washington, is building a background data analytics program for this purpose. HMIS background data analytics are generated with the use of Microsoft Power BI, an interactive data visualization software product developed with a primary focus on business intelligence. The background analytics are developed to connect disparate data sets, transform and clean the data into a data model, and create a platform for sharing data that may warrant further evaluation. As in most organizations, labor charging generates a large amount of records and represents a significant cost to the company. HMIS conducts traditional reviews, such as monthly floor checks, to ensure compliance and understanding of labor charging practices. HMIS also utilizes background data analytics for identifying potentially actionable data that is not easily evaluated during traditional floor checks. Several examples include analytics that capture background data, such as the pre-loading of time, time sheet corrections, approvals of time sheets outside of an employee's organization, and save history for time sheets. This is real-time data that can be used to identify potential errors or trends, thus providing respective employees and managers the ability to correct, improve or provide additional training. In some cases, data analytics quickly identifies potential noncompliant activities. For example, if an employee was to update their daily time sheet with a training code while on overtime, a background analytic would identify a red flag immediately because this is not something HMIS typically allows. This flag would generate additional investigations to validate the time was correctly recorded as training on overtime, and that training on overtime was approved consistent with company procedures. This review could also determine the employee simply made a mistake when updating their time sheet by not identifying the proper code of account on their time sheet. The key in this example is that the anomaly is identified, reviewed, updated or corrected if necessary, so the proper actions are taken prior to invoicing the cost to the DOE, or respective customer. It is important to know some data anomalies may simply represent information outside of a pre-conceived expectation because there is not a clear indicator. In addition, because the analytic is pulling live data (i.e., data as it exists on the employee's time sheet even though the time sheet has not yet been submitted for approval), the situation is being addressed as a current event. For example, if an employee is involved in a vehicle accident with a government vehicle, they are required to submit to a drug test and charge the time associated with the drug test to administrative time (A-time). The background analytic identifies additional charges to A-time, but a quick evaluation may determine the charge is appropriate with no further action required. Background data analytics can also be utilized for non-labor related transactions. For example, analytics ensure employees with cell phone stipends have their number appropriately listed and loaded with necessary software as required by company procedures. Other examples include analytics to identify if the electronic bill of materials (eBOM) requestor and approving manager are the same individual, and background comparisons between employee names, addresses, etc., against vendor listings. As a result of using innovative processes and reports to streamline the review of data, HMIS will continue to expand background data analytics and the development of dashboards for senior management to enhance compliance-based reviews and analysis to minimize risk of invoicing unallowable costs to the government. Incorporating data analytics into critical work elements allows companies to anticipate, manage and respond to adverse events more effectively while minimizing risk. (authors)
